Archaeoastronomy: Decoding Ancient Sites Celestial Alignments

Image
Archaeoastronomy is a fascinating interdisciplinary field that investigates the astronomical practices, celestial knowledge, and cosmic worldviews of ancient cultures. It delves into how prehistoric and historical societies observed the sky, interpreted celestial phenomena, and integrated these understandings into their architecture, rituals, and daily lives. Far from being a mere curiosity, archaeoastronomy reveals profound insights into the intellectual sophistication, technological capabilities, and spiritual beliefs of our ancestors, demonstrating their deep connection to the cosmos. This field bridges the gap between archaeology, astronomy, anthropology, and history, offering a unique lens through which to understand human civilization's relationship with the heavens. From the precise alignments of megalithic structures to the complex calendrical systems of Mesoamerican civilizations, the evidence of ancient astronomical observation is abundant and diverse.
